WebAll fishing rules and regulations still apply. See the Washington Sport Fishing Rules pamphlet. Anglers with a valid two-pole endorsement may use up to three hooks on each line. For more information, call WDFW’s licensing department at 360-902-2464. Exclusions. Two-pole fishing is allowed on most lakes, ponds and reservoirs across the state.
